Learning disability annual health checks: a GP resource

National resources

The Royal College of General Practitioners – Health Checks for People with Learning Disabilities Toolkit contains a wealth of information to support GP’s with annual health checks.

The NHS Annual Health Checks – Learning Disabilities page provides background information in the rationale for Learning Disabilities Annual Health Checks.

Improving identification of people with a learning disability: guidance for general practice for guidance on appropriate use of SNOMED codes.

For patients that cannot attend for their annual health checks there is an EMIS Annual Health Checks Template for Home Visits

Mencap’s resources about Annual Health Checks includes a video and several easy read documents that can be useful to patients with a learning disability.

Cardiff and Vale University Health Board have made a training video to help health staff, including receptionists support people with learning disabilities

The NHS have produced this infographic Population Screening Timeline people may find helpful

The NHS Going to Hospital Page includes useful information, such as easy read guides to Reasonable Adjustments, accessing records and consent.

Patients may benefit from a Hospital passport (PDF, 1.22 KB). This is a patient held record, people can complete with their Circle of Support. Enfield have produced a ‘Top Tips’ document (PDF, 1.22 KB) to help people get the most benefit from their hospital passport.
